/ context

A business running blind on its booking tool

The company ran everything inside its inspection software, Spectora, with no CRM underneath it. Years of client and referring-agent history sat locked in one tool, with no attribution and follow-up handled from memory.

BasisWeb built the production system around it. A GoHighLevel CRM from scratch, a custom Spectora-to-GoHighLevel bridge running on self-hosted n8n, a full historical migration, and marketing-to-revenue attribution. It has run in production since May 2026 on the business's real booking, report, and payment events, for eight inspectors plus support staff, a roughly 50-service catalog, 22 custom fields, and 4 pipelines.

/ the scope correction

We put the bad news in writing while there was still time

The original scope assumed a two-way sync. Discovery proved the platform is outbound-webhook-only, with no inbound write path. That was not the answer anyone wanted.

We wrote it up as an explicit scope change while there was still time to act on it, then re-architected around the real constraint: forward-direction enrichment plus a one-time historical backfill. No pretend sync, no quiet workaround that breaks in six months.

/ what holds it together

Built to survive a bad day, not just a demo

A composite-keyed dedup ledger means a vendor retry storm cannot double-write the CRM. Phone-collision handling retries without the colliding field and tags the record for a person to review instead of guessing.

An hourly failure poll emails the team the moment a production event fails, and a weekly automated health pass runs 24 checks against the whole system. The zero in the stat band above is not luck, it is the alerting.
